Output bb3177ede6127fad667fd9824ebf5dd500ff3e95f4cb8305ce3df3b69b3b047e:121

value
28094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826cb849215edebc3649cd454cf7883c28abc78c OP_EQUAL
address
3Dae1UEkFuFZkkxkai4BscrbUJU3JvZqJy
transaction
bb3177ede6127fad667fd9824ebf5dd500ff3e95f4cb8305ce3df3b69b3b047e